Damian Hinds MP speaks at Community First East Hampshire AGM

Wednesday 21st September 2011

Community First East Hampshire celebrated a year of success with a visit from East Hampshire MP Damian Hinds.

On Friday 9 September, Community First East Hampshire held its Annual General Meeting at the Liphook Millennium Centre.

Attended by over 70 members, volunteers and guests, the meeting celebrated the achievements of the organisation over the last 12 months and looked forward to the challenging times ahead.

Damian Hinds MP was the keynote speaker and spoke on Government Priorities, Localism and the Big Society.

He explained that the coalition is committed to localism through de-regulation and decentralisation, empowering councils, groups and organisations within their communities.

He ended by highlighting the three main challenges as he sees them, use of resources, finding easy ways to help and supporting volunteering.

The AGM was followed by an Interagency Forum which involved three workshops on the changing face of healthcare in England, attracting young volunteers and the new South Downs National Park.

The day concluded with a group activity provided The Phoenix Theatre in Bordon
